    What is Abilify?

    Abilify (aripiprazole) was developed by Otsuka Pharmaceutical in partnership with Bristol-Myers Squibb. Abilify was developed as a dopamine partial agonist—a new type of antipsychotic drug which can act either as an agonist or antagonist based on the chemical composition of the consumer’s brain. The drug helps balance the chemicals in the brain. Development started in 1995, and by 2002,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) approved the medication for use to treat schizophrenia. Over the years, Abilify was approved to treat a series of other conditions. Today, Abilify is used to treat schizophrenia, bipolar disorder, depression, and autism. Some of the positive results of taking Abilify include the following: decreased hallucinations, improved concentration, clearer thoughts, more positive thoughts, reduced nervousness, and controlled mood swings, for example.

    Some Side Effects of Taking Abilify

    Although many people see improvements in their schizophrenia, bipolar disorder, depression, and autism, many of these improvements come with unwanted side effects. Some mild side effects of taking Abilify include the following: trouble sleeping, headache, weight gain, constipation, blurred vision, drooling, excess saliva, dizziness, lightheadedness, tiredness, nausea, vomiting, and drowsiness, for example. Although many of these symptoms could be concerning, they are often tolerable and temporary. In addition to the side effects mentioned above, Abilify could cause a variety of severe side effects could occur.

    Some of the critical side effects of Abilify are listed below:

    • Fainting
    • Increased anxiety or depression
    • Increased mood swings
    • Muscle spasms
    • Respiratory issues during sleep
    • Restlessness
    • Seizures
    • Severe allergic reactions
    • Suicidal thoughts
    • Tremors
    • Trouble swallowing
    • Trouble controlling urges

    As you can see, taking Abilify can result in many severe side effects. One side effect, in particular, can lead to a catastrophic lifestyle change for those affected—trouble controlling urges.

    Compulsive Gambling after Taking Abilify

    As discussed above, those who take Abilify might suffer intense urges and the inability to control these urges. Compulsive gambling behaviors can arise from these urges. Pathological gambling, or compulsive gambling, occurs when a person is unable to resist the urge or impulse to spend time gambling. Compulsive gambling might consist of the following signs:

    • Gambling as a coping mechanism
    • Gambling to recover lost money
    • Irritability and restlessness when not gambling
    • Lying to hide the extent of their gambling
    • Need to increase the amount of money being gambled to reach satisfaction
    • Participating in criminal activities to fund gambling
    • Preoccupation with gambling and planning to gamble
    • Sacrificing personal and professional relationships for gambling
    • Unsuccessful attempts to control the urge to gamble

    In general, only people with specific characteristics develop gambling addictions. For example, mental health, age, sex, and personality characteristics can increase the risk of developing a gambling addiction. Those with friends or family members with gambling addictions are also more likely to become compulsive gamblers. However, since Abilify can cause compulsive gambling, people can develop gambling additions regardless of the risk factors.

    Can Victims File a Claim?

    If you suffered sudden uncontrollable urges to gamble after taking Ability, could you file a claim? Could Bristol-Myers Squibb be found liable for your gambling addiction? All companies, including pharmaceutical companies, have the responsibility to ensure that their products are safe for use before making them available to the public. If any potential side effects exist, companies must provide users with clear warnings. Unfortunately, there was a failure to warn users of Abilify about the dangers of developing compulsive behavior such as pathological gambling. Because of this, those affected might claim that Bristol-Myers Squibb defectively designed and manufactured the prescription medication.

    Based on records of early trials of Abilify, manufacturers were aware that taking the prescription medication could cause hypersexuality—or sexual addiction. In 2012, approximately ten years after the introduction of Abilify, the manufacturer updated the medication’s warning label to include the risk of pathological gambling in Europe. In 2015, Canada also saw a change in Abilify’s warning label. In 2016, fourteen years after the introduction of Abilify and four years after the initial mention of the risk of compulsive behaviors on the European label, the United States finally saw a warning regarding compulsive behavior when taking Abilify. However, the warning is hidden between pages of other information. Although there was a public announcement about the dangers of the drug, there is still no black box warning.

    The Statute of Limitations for Abilify Claims

    If you are interested in suing Abilify’s manufacturer for the failure to warn of the risk of developing compulsive gambling, you must file your claim as soon as possible to preserve your right to sue. A statute of limitations is a timeline that establishes the time that victims have to file a lawsuit after suffering an injury. If their claims are not filed within the deadline established by the statute of limitations, they might lose their right to sue. If you were affected by Abilify, you are subject to a statute of limitations. How much do you have to file a lawsuit? If you suffered compulsive gambling after taking Abilify, you have two years from the date that you discovered that your gambling was caused by the medication to file a lawsuit. Although the statute of limitations is a strict timeline, the time victims have to sue can be tolled or extended.
